The "Nigerian Scammer" epidemic to be featured on 20/20 on Friday, Dec 8th at 10pm ET. - I verified this much wink

I also hear that the story is supposedly going to show the problem as a government-endorsed, and culturally accepted practice in Nigeria.
The "I Go Chop Your Dollar" song will be used to underscore the perception that Nigerians widely endorse 419.

My biggest agro is that they continually say "Nigerian Scammer" - it irks me.

Anyway, don't miss it - ABC 20/20 on Friday at 10pm ET. Will also be aired on World News

Can you believe this? On ABC's 20/20, tonight, they were talking about scammers and all of that, and we all know where it led to. NIGERIANS.

So they talked about a whole bunch of stuffs, and scammers caught on tape and all of that. So well, here's what happened. They showed that we CELEBRATE SCAMMING IN OUR COUNTRY!!

HOW you ask? They said that we celebrate it oo, and they showed Nkem owoh's "i go chop your dollar". They said that Nigerian calls oyinbo's mugus.

Well considering nkem's song, i wouldn't blame them for the conclusion they made.
